Output dba0c8b416019627bf62b67ca49b78a05564ec3bdb5bee89bcdd1ee4eebb6328:60

value
2465224
script pubkey
OP_0 OP_PUSHBYTES_20 177a2a31e2771313a8ed8f2e4fddd9e8715cff4f
address
bc1qzaaz5v0zwuf3828d3uhylhweapc4el605xsaf0
transaction
dba0c8b416019627bf62b67ca49b78a05564ec3bdb5bee89bcdd1ee4eebb6328
confirmations
241818
spent
true